Emilio Estevez was cast in the role of Jack Harmon to create a sense of shock in the audience when he died early in this movie. Reza Badiyi, the person responsible for directing more episodes of the original Mission: Impossible (1966) television series than anyone else, was asked by the head of Paramount Pictures to be present on the set for consulting and advising. According to Martin Landau, in an earlier treatment, the original plan was to bring back the entire original cast of the television series, just to kill them all off in the first act. Emilio Estevez appears in the first Mission: Impossible in an uncredited role as IMF agent Jack Harmon, which is fitting since Tom Cruise had previously made an uncredited cameo of his own in Estevez' earlier film Young Guns (1988). Paramount Pictures owned the rights to the television series, and had tried for years to make a movie version, but had failed to come up with a viable treatment.
